Abstract
In a method and apparatus for determining the impressing depth of a tire on a motor vehicle disk wheel, the impressing depth is determined using a wheel balancing machine structure from the wheel rim width, the axial spacing of an abutment surface on the main mounting shaft of the machine from a reference plane of the machine, and the axial spacing of one of the two measurement points for the wheel rim width from the reference plane.
